final year project-batch 11

22
PROJECT TITLE: DESIGN AND IMPL EMENT A TION OF A WORK PLANNER FOR ST AFF S CHEDULING CASE STUDY: RDB/IT By: UMUHIRE Nadine GS20060696 UMUT ONI Alice GS20060701 Supervisor: Mr . MASABO E mmanuel

Upload: kanyesigye-enock

Post on 07-Apr-2018

223 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 1/22

PROJECT TITLE:

DESIGN AND IMPLEMENTATION OF A WORK

PLANNER FOR STAFF SCHEDULING

CASE STUDY: RDB/IT

By: UMUHIRE Nadine GS20060696

UMUTONI Alice GS20060701

Supervisor: Mr. MASABO Emmanuel

Page 2: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 2/22

Overview

This research project was carried out in the area of

Information Technology (IT), based on RDB/IT organization.

The said system will be used by three categories of users such

as :

� Administrator empowered to maintain the overall Work

planner system;

� Team Leader acts as spokesperson and main responsible

user; and

� Team Member to perform or implement given activities.

Page 3: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 3/22

Problem Statement

The lack of efficient and effective means of planning and

management in an organization is a critical challenge in working

environments.

This can lead to some problems :

� Delay of staffs to meet the deadline of assigned activities

� Struggle to identify progress of ongoing activities.

In order to deliver better quality and timely results across the

organization, work performance need to be enhanced by modern

tools and technologies.

Page 4: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 4/22

Objectives of the Project

� General Objective:

o To provide an effective way of planning, management

and tracking activities· schedules

� Specific Objectives:

o To provide the administrator and team leader with

the ability to assign activities to team members;

o To ensure the ability for managers to control

activities;

o To enable easy collaboration.

Page 5: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 5/22

Project Hypothesis

´The use of a work planner for staff scheduling will

improve the efficiency and effectiveness of an

organization by providing its staff with an easy way of

collaborating toward a common goal to optimize

successful delivery.µ

Page 6: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 6/22

Scope of the ProjectThis research project is focused on the design and

implementation of a web based work planner for staff

scheduling that will permit:

� Assignment of activities to team members;

� Tracking the progress of assigned activities

Page 7: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 7/22

Project Interests

� Personal Interest

o To apply the knowledge acquired during academic studies;

o To improve our knowledge in IT;

o To develop professional aptitude for our future career.

� Society Interest

o To develop an efficient and effective system to plan,

manage and track activities· progress of RDB/IT·s staff.

Page 8: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 8/22

Research Methodology

� Data Collection

o Primary data collection

o Secondary data collection

Page 9: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 9/22

Page 10: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 10/22

Tools Used

We have used the combination of the following tools:

� ASP.NET 3.5 in C# 3.0 as the web development framework

� Microsoft SQL Server 2005 as the database management

system

� ADO.NET as the model for interacting with the database

� IIS as the web server

Hardware equipment used:

� 3.2 Ghz of processor speed

� 1Gb of RAM

� 80 Gb of Hard disk space

Page 11: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 11/22

System Analysis and Design

� UML Diagrams

oUse Case Diagram

oActivity DiagramsoSequence Diagram

Page 12: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 12/22

Use Case Diagram

Page 13: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 13/22

Administrator·s Activity Diagram

Page 14: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 14/22

Team Leader·s Activity Diagram

Page 15: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 15/22

Team Member·s Activity Diagram

Page 16: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 16/22

Sequence Diagram

Page 17: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 17/22

Data Flow Diagram (DFD)

� Context Diagram

Page 18: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 18/22

DFD Level 0

Page 19: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 19/22

Entity Relationship Diagram (ERD)

Page 20: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 20/22

CONCLUSION AND RECOMMENDATIONS

� Conclusion: The web based Work Planner can successfully:

oTo provide the ability for the administrator and the team

leader to assign activities to team members;

oTo ensure the ability for managers to control activities;

oTo enable an easy collaboration.

� R ecommendations: For further work, we are suggesting to

enhance this software adding lacking modules such as:

o Evaluation process to assess staffs commitment

o Establish a way of sending reports through e-mails

Page 21: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 21/22

T H A N K Y O U

Page 22: Final Year Project-Batch 11

8/6/2019 Final Year Project-Batch 11

http://slidepdf.com/reader/full/final-year-project-batch-11 22/22

We welcome your Questions